Brick Laying Preparation Dig the patio area 67 inches deep. Cover the ground surface with landscape fabric to reduce the growth of weeds between the patio bricks. Cover the landscape fabric using a layer of coarse gravel and tamp it down. The gravel layer should be 34 inches deep (3 inches if you have dug the patio to 6 inches, 4 if you have dug it to 7 inches). Once this gravel layer is in place, you are ready to begin laying the bricks.
Read the manufacturer's directions carefully. Not all wood burning stoves are built alike and it really is important to be clear on your particular wood stove's requirements and limitations. By way of example, you do not want to accidentally block a vent when you place your wood stove because you didn't know the vent was there. The metals in different kinds of wood stoves heat up and radiate heat differently, which means different wood stoves will need to be placed a different minimum distance from the walls, walkways and other objects.
